Overview of the Private Pilot Certificate
The Private Pilot Certificate is the foundation for all other pilot ratings, allowing individuals to fly for recreation or personal transportation. It requires a minimum of 40 flight hours, including 20 hours of flight training and 10 hours of solo flight. The certificate is granted upon passing a practical test, which includes both an oral exam and a flight demonstration. Key topics covered in the exam include weather briefings, navigation, and aircraft systems. It is a critical step for those pursuing higher ratings like instrument or commercial pilot certifications.
Weather Briefings and Navigation
Weather briefings and navigation are critical components of flight preparation. Pilots must understand how to interpret METAR and TAF reports to assess flight conditions. Navigation skills include using GPS, VOR, and NDB systems. Knowledge of NOTAMs ensures awareness of airspace restrictions and hazards. Effective navigation also involves understanding aircraft performance and fuel management. Instrument Meteorological Conditions (IMC)
Instrument Meteorological Conditions (IMC) refer to weather situations where pilots must rely solely on aircraft instruments for navigation and control. Understanding IMC is critical for safe flight operations. Key topics include cloud base, visibility, and decision altitudes. Pilots must master procedures for entering and exiting IMC, as well as navigating through instrument approaches. The guide emphasizes the importance of weather briefings, forecasts, and ATC communication. Essential skills for IMC include maintaining situational awareness and adhering to standardized procedures. Common exam questions focus on identifying IMC thresholds and emergency escape maneuvers, ensuring pilots are prepared for real-world scenarios.
Approach Procedures and Instrument Navigation
Understanding approach procedures and instrument navigation is essential for safe and precise landings. The guide covers various types of approaches, including ILS, VOR, and RNAV, and explains how to interpret approach plates. It emphasizes the use of navigation tools like GPS, DME, and ADF. Pilots learn how to execute missed approaches and handle deviations from the planned route. Common exam questions focus on identifying approach categories, calculating decision altitudes, and interpreting weather minimums. Effective navigation requires mastery of both equipment and procedures, ensuring pilots can navigate safely in low-visibility conditions.
